Order αs(Q2) QCD corrections to the polarised e+~e- Λ~X
V. Ravindran
Abstract
The importance of polarised gluons fragmenting into Λ in the polarised e+ e- annihilation is discussed using the Altarelli-Parisi evolution equations satisfied by the quark and gluon fragmentation functions. In this context, the polarised fragmentaion function g1Λ(x,Q2) appearing in the cross section is discussed within the parton model. We relate this fragmentation function to the quark, anti-quark and gluon fragmentation functions and also find the QCD corrections to order αs.
